What are device files in Linux?

In short, a device file (also called as a special file) is an interface for a device driver that appears in a file system as if it were an ordinary file. This allows software to interact with the device driver using standard input/output system calls, which simplifies many tasks.

Where are device files stored in Linux?

All Linux device files are located in the /dev directory, which is an integral part of the root (/) filesystem because these device files must be available to the operating system during the boot process.

Why device is a file in Linux?

In Linux various special files can be found under the directory /dev . These files are called device files and behave unlike ordinary files. These files are an interface to the actual driver (part of the Linux kernel) which in turn accesses the hardware.

Why does Linux treat all devices as files?

The advantage of treating all devices like files in Unix is that it provides a uniform interface for I/O on Unix systems. Programs written to manage files will also work to manage devices, and vice versa.

What is the purpose of device files?

These special files allow an application program to interact with a device by using its device driver via standard input/output system calls. Using standard system calls simplifies many programming tasks, and leads to consistent user-space I/O mechanisms regardless of device features and functions.

How the device files are created in Linux?

In most Linux desktop systems, the udev daemon picks up that information and accordingly creates the device files. udev can be further configured using its configuration files to tune the device file names, their permissions, their types, etc.

How do devices work in Linux?

Linux allows you to include device drivers at kernel build time via its configuration scripts. When these drivers are initialized at boot time they may not discover any hardware to control. Other drivers can be loaded as kernel modules when they are needed.

How do device files work?

These special files allow an application program to interact with a device by using its device driver via standard input/output system calls. Additionally, device files are useful for accessing system resources that have no connection with any actual device, such as data sinks and random number generators.

Is everything on Linux a file?

That is in fact true although it is just a generalization concept, in Unix and its derivatives such as Linux, everything is considered as a file. Although everything in Linux is a file, there are certain special files that are more than just a file for example sockets and named pipes.

What is a mounted storage device in Linux?

A mounted storage device has its file system grafted onto that tree so that it appears to be an integral part of one cohesive file system. The newly mounted file system will be accessible via the directory to which it is mounted. That directory is called the mount point for that file system.

What is the name of the storage drive in Linux?

This includes hardware like storage drives, which are represented on the system as files in the /dev directory. Typically, files representing storage devices start with sd or hd followed by a letter. For instance, the first drive on a server is usually something like /dev/sda.
